Book Description
This volume provides analytical definitions and discussions of the key concepts in archaeology. For each of the more than seventy terms covered, the dictionary provides an examination of the development of the term and an analysis of the key thinkers and writing involved in its development. Each entry concludes with a bibliographical essay designed to cover the original sources of vital importance in the development of the concept---sources such as review articles that provide access to a sizable portion of the literature related to the concept, and a selection of recent publications representative of current directions in research. Additional access to the material covered is provided by an index of concepts and terms and an index of names. This is the first reference dictionary to deal with the concepts in archaeology and, as such, will be useful to scholars and students in the field, as well as libraries supporting research in archaeology.

Book Description
The terms and concepts selected for inclusion in this dictionary of archaeology are those most in need of definition and explanation for persons outside the field. This book is addressed to them, as well as to students of archaeology. In cases where the terminology has not become standardized, alternative terms have been included. The use of jargon terms has been avoided in favor of standard English words. Entries comprise 4 parts. First, brief statements give the current meaning of a concept. Next, discursive paragraphs trace a concept's historical origins and connotative development. Then, sources mentioned in part 2 are cited, and additional notes briefly highlight other aspects of individual references. Part 4 includes sources of additional info.

Book Description
The most wide-ranging and up-to-date dictionary of its kind providing useful information about archaeological terms, themes, theories, sites, places, artefacts and archaeologists ... from amphora to ziggurat. Will be especially useful to students, amateurs and enthusiasts, travellers, and anyone seeking to extend their knowledge horizon. Taking AD 1700 as the cut-off point, the dictionary contains over 5,000 concise and often referenced entries mostly relating to Britain, Europe and the Americas. The dictionary concludes with eleven `Quick Reference' sections on subjects such as conventions, stratigraphy, geology, periods, dynasties, emperors and rulers. The second edition is fully updated, with new evidence, insights and entires, and is now accompanied by dedicated webpages and bibliographic web links.
